Lightning Deal and Coupon Impact Calculator
A promotion is worth running only if it earns more than the profit you would have made without it. This calculator compares two worlds: a baseline in which you sell your normal volume at your normal price, and a deal window in which you sell a larger volume at a discounted price, pay a fixed Lightning Deal or coupon fee, and give up the full-price margin on every unit that would have sold anyway. The difference between those two numbers is the only figure that matters, and it is frequently negative. Enter your own numbers below; the fields load with a worked example already filled in.

How the deal impact calculation works
The model is a comparison, not a single margin figure. It builds the two scenarios separately and subtracts one from the other, so the answer is always framed against the alternative of doing nothing:
- Deal price = normal price × (1 − discount rate). This is the price the buyer pays during the window, and every downstream figure keys off it.
- Profit per unit at the normal price = normal price − (normal price × referral rate) − all-in unit cost. The all-in cost is everything except the referral fee: landed product cost, fulfillment, allocated storage, advertising per unit, and any returns reserve.
- Profit per unit at the deal price = deal price − (deal price × referral rate) − all-in unit cost. The referral fee shrinks with the price, which is the only cost that moves in your favor. Every other cost is unchanged, which is why the discount lands almost entirely on your margin.
- Baseline profit for the window = profit per unit at the normal price × units you would have sold anyway. This is the profit you are giving up to run the promotion, and it is the number most deal analyses omit.
- Deal profit for the window = profit per unit at the deal price × units expected at the deal price − the fixed deal fee. Note that the deal units figure is the total for the window, so it already contains the baseline units, now sold at a discount.
- Incremental result = deal profit − baseline profit. Positive means the promotion paid for itself. Negative is the amount it cost you relative to leaving the listing alone.
- Break-even volume = (baseline profit + deal fee) ÷ profit per unit at the deal price. This is the number of discounted units required to get back to the profit you would have made anyway. When the profit per unit at the deal price is zero or negative, no volume reaches break-even and the calculator says so rather than printing a meaningless number.
Two properties of this arithmetic drive nearly every bad deal decision. The first is that the deal fee is fixed and the per-unit economics are variable, so the fee is almost never the problem. A $150 event fee spread over 400 units is $0.38 per unit; a discount that pushes the unit into negative contribution is unbounded, because it grows with every sale. The sign of the profit per unit at the deal price decides whether volume is your friend or your enemy, and it decides that before you have sold a single unit.
The second is cannibalization: the units that would have sold at full price regardless. Those buyers were already going to convert, and the promotion simply handed them a discount. If your baseline is 120 units and the deal moves 400, only 280 units are genuinely incremental, but all 400 carry the reduced margin. Sellers who compare deal-window revenue against a quiet week, rather than against the profit the same week would have produced on its own, systematically overstate what promotions earn.
Set the discount against the break-even price for the SKU, which you can compute on the FBA profit calculator. If the deal price sits below that figure, you are selling below cost, and the honest question is not whether the deal is profitable but whether the loss is buying something worth the money.
Worked example: a 20% deal on a $24.99 SKU
These are the values the calculator loads with, so you can see the method and the widget agree. Figures are illustrative.
- Normal price $24.99, discount 20%, deal fee $150.00, all-in unit cost excluding referral $17.32, referral rate 15%, baseline 120 units, expected deal volume 400 units.
- Deal price: $24.99 × 0.80 = $19.99.
- Profit per unit at the normal price: $24.99 − $3.75 − $17.32 = $3.92.
- Profit per unit at the deal price: $19.99 − $3.00 − $17.32 = -$0.33, a loss on every unit sold.
- Baseline profit: $3.92 × 120 = $470.58.
- Deal profit: (-$0.33 × 400) − $150.00 = -$280.72.
- Incremental result: -$280.72 − $470.58 = -$751.30. Break-even volume: not achievable at any volume.
This scenario is deliberately a losing one, because it is the shape of deal that gets scheduled most often. The break-even price on this SKU is $20.38, so a 20% discount to $19.99 sells below cost from the first unit. Selling 800 units instead of 400 would roughly double the negative contribution, not recover it. The fee is the small part of the damage: cannibalizing 120 full-price units costs $470.58 on its own, more than three times the $150.00 event fee.
When a losing deal is still the right call
Running a promotion at a loss is a legitimate tactic in three situations, provided the loss is deliberate and budgeted rather than accidental. The first is rank acquisition, where a burst of velocity lifts organic position on a target keyword and the gain persists after the price returns to normal. The second is inventory clearance, where units are approaching an aged inventory surcharge or a fourth-quarter peak storage rate, and paying a small loss now avoids a larger carrying cost later, as modelled on the storage and aged inventory calculator. The third is launch velocity, where early sales and reviews are worth more than the margin sacrificed to get them.
In all three cases, the discipline is the same: decide the maximum acceptable loss before scheduling, treat that figure as a marketing or clearance line in the budget, and check afterward whether the intended benefit actually arrived. A deal that loses $751.30 to buy rank is a defensible investment if rank was the goal and rank was gained. The same deal run because the discount looked modest is simply a mistake that took six weeks to appear in a settlement report.
Frequently asked questions
Why does selling more units in a deal sometimes increase the loss?
Because the deal fee is fixed but the per-unit economics are not. If every discounted unit earns a positive contribution, extra volume dilutes the fee and the deal improves as it scales. If the discounted price falls below your break-even price, every additional unit adds another small loss on top of the fee, so volume makes the result worse rather than better. Check the sign of the profit per unit at the deal price before you look at anything else.
What is cannibalization and how do I estimate it?
Cannibalization is the share of deal units that would have sold at full price anyway, so the discount on them buys you nothing. Estimate it from the trailing four weeks of units sold in a comparable window, adjusted for seasonality, and enter that figure in the baseline field. Sellers who ignore it consistently overstate deal performance, because the promotion gets credit for demand it did not create.
Is it ever right to run a deal that loses money?
Yes, when the loss buys something you actually need: search rank on a launch, velocity ahead of a competitive window, or clearing aged units before a long-term storage or aged inventory surcharge lands. The discipline is to size the loss in advance and treat it as a marketing or clearance budget line rather than discovering it in a settlement report six weeks later.
How is a coupon different from a Lightning Deal in this model?
The structure is the same and the model handles both. A Lightning Deal or Best Deal carries a fixed fee per event, while a coupon carries a redemption fee charged per unit redeemed. For a coupon, multiply the per-redemption fee by the units you expect to redeem and enter that product in the deal fee field, then read the result the same way.
Should the referral fee be recalculated at the deal price?
Yes, and this calculator does it. The referral fee is a percentage of the price the buyer actually pays, so a lower price lowers the fee proportionally. That partial offset is real but small: a 15% referral rate returns only $0.15 of every dollar you discount, which is why a 20% price cut never costs anything close to 20% of profit.
